當前位置:編程學習大全網 - 源碼下載 - 如何評價 Swift 語言

如何評價 Swift 語言

Swift是Apple在WWDC2014所發布的壹門編程語言,用來撰寫OS X和iOS應用程序[1]。在設計Swift時.就有意和Objective-C***存,Objective-C是Apple操作系統在導入Swift前使用的編程語言

Swift是供iOS和OS X應用編程的新編程語言,基於C和Objective-C,而卻沒有C的壹些兼容約束。Swift采用了安全的編程模式和添加現代的功能來使得編程更加簡單、靈活和有趣。界面則基於廣受人民群眾愛戴的Cocoa和Cocoa Touch框架,展示了軟件開發的新方向。

2010 年 7 月LLVM 編譯器的原作者暨蘋果開發者工具部門總監克裏斯·拉特納(Chris Lattner)開始著手 Swift 編程語言的工作,還有壹個 dogfooding 團隊大力參與其中。至2014年6月發表,Swift大約歷經4年的開發期。蘋果宣稱Swift的特點是:快速、現代、安全、互動,且全面優於Objective-C語言。Xcode Playgrounds功能是Swift為蘋果開發工具帶來的最大創新,該功能提供強大的互動效果,能讓Swift源代碼在撰寫過程中能實時顯示出其運行結果。拉特納本人強調,Playgrounds很大程度是受到布雷特·維克多(Bret Victor)理念的啟發。

JavaEye的創始人Robbin發表意見:“對程序員來說,熟悉Swift語法也不過壹天時間足夠了。關鍵是要提供高級數據類型,簡化Cocoa類庫,否則用不用Swift都沒區別。”

  • 上一篇:請教CVM在機頂盒的移植過程
  • 下一篇:ppt如何自動生成目錄
  • copyright 2024編程學習大全網